[jira] Commented: (AXIS2-78) MTOM Interop Test Scenarios

Posted by "Thilina Gunarathne (JIRA)" <ji...@apache.org>.
    [ http://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/AXIS2-78?page=comments#action_12320398 ] 

Thilina Gunarathne commented on AXIS2-78:
-----------------------------------------

Saminda has  succesfully done the interop tests with Whitemesa endpoint (with some changes like disabling chunking, cause Whitemesa endpoint does not support chunking)..

He has also tested all those tests with our interop service and he has got more or less same responses as from Whitemesa endpoint. This confirms that out interop service is working as accepted....

Can we host this service as an interop endpoint......(in apache ?...), Saminda is working on an JSP interop client, which we can host with the service in the future...
